Output 90eff95e6b99179370750351b60118f913aed8d65b46ddd8f4110384a79560e7:4

value
1751031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56524e7635967d39479ab562973def55fa1cef0a OP_EQUAL
address
39ZSdo9U6ywg8yEUVdpVuYt9M4U9qPPCea
transaction
90eff95e6b99179370750351b60118f913aed8d65b46ddd8f4110384a79560e7
confirmations
276734
spent
true